Who We Are

BUDS-UK (Batticaloa Underprivileged Development Society – United Kingdom) is a charity registered in England and Wales under charity number 1081305. Our registered address is 98 Kings Road, Harrow, HA2 9JQ, United Kingdom. For any privacy-related enquiries, contact secretary@budsuk.org.

How Long We Keep Your Data

  • Gift Aid records: retained for a minimum of 6 years after the end of the tax year (HMRC requirement).
  • Donation records: typically 7 years for accounting and audit purposes.
  • Mailing list contacts: until you unsubscribe.
  • General enquiries: up to 2 years.
